Digital_Vulture: I first extracted the areas of the head to what would be the hair.
-Used the move brush to create the general shape.
-then for the illusion of hair strands, just a standard brush with alpha36
with lazymouse on
-nudge brush for the curly effect.
-displace brush for adding volume without destroying the detail underneath.
